To communicate with IDT, the phone must be forced into a low-level USB downloading state. For Huawei devices, this is usually achieved by dismantling the phone and using the . This involves shorting a specific gold contact point on the motherboard to the ground (shielding) while plugging the USB cable into the computer. This triggers the required COM port connection without needing the phone to boot. Step 3: Configuring the Tool
